What is y squared + 2 y - 35 / y + 7​
lutik1710 [3]

Answer:

y - 5

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

\frac{y^2+2y-35}{y+7}

Factorise the numerator

y² + 2y - 35 = (y + 7)(y - 5), thus fraction can be expressed as

\frac{(y+7)(y-5)}{y+7}

Cancel the factor (y + 7) on the numerator/ denominator, leaving

y - 5

Question
Kay [80]

Answer:

f(x)=2(x-2)(x^2+64)

Step-by-step explanation:

A standard polynomial in factored form is given by:

f(x)=a(x-p)(x-q)...

Where <em>p</em> and <em>q</em> are the zeros.

We want to find a third-degree polynomial with zeros <em>x</em> = 2 and <em>x </em>= -8i and equals 320 when <em>x </em>= 4.

First, by the Complex Root Theorem, if <em>x</em> = -8i is a root, then <em>x </em>= 8i must also be a root.

Therefore, we acquire:

f(x)=a(x-(2))(x-(-8i))(x-(8i))

Simplify:

f(x)=a(x-2)(x+8i)(x-8i)

Expand the second and third factors:

=(x+8i)x+(x+8i)(-8i)\\\\=(x^2+8ix)+(-8ix-64i^2)\\\\=(x^2)+(8ix-8ix)+(-64i^2)\\\\=x^2-64(-1)\\\\ =x^2+64

Hence, our function is now:

f(x)=a(x-2)(x^2+64)

It equals 320 when <em>x</em> = 4. Therefore:

320=a(4-2)(4^2+64)

Solve for <em>a</em>. Evaluate:

320=(2)(80)a

So:

320=160a\Rightarrow a=2

Our third-degree polynomial equation is:

f(x)=2(x-2)(x^2+64)

There are 11 students on the tennis team. The coach selects 3 of them to go to atennis clinic. In how many ways can he choose 3
Komok [63]

Answer:

165 ways

Step-by-step explanation:

Selection deals with combination

There are a total of 11 from which 3 are to be selected

        11C3 = 11!/3!(11-3)!

                 = 11!/(3!x8!)

                 =(11x10x9x8!)/(3x2x8!)

                 =11x10x9/6

                 =11x5x3 = 165 ways
